What Counts as a Plumbing Emergency in Roseville?
Not every plumbing issue requires an urgent call. But in our climate, some problems escalate fast. Here's what's considered a real plumbing emergency:
- Burst or Frozen Pipes: During heavy winter freezes in Roseville, pipes in older homes near Har Mar Mall or along County Road B can freeze and burst. If you see water spraying or flooding, it's an emergency.
- Sewer Backups: Heavy spring rains in Minnesota can overwhelm sewer systems. If multiple drains are clogged or you notice sewage coming up through drains, call immediately.
- No Hot Water in Winter: With our cold winters, losing hot water isn't just uncomfortable—it can be dangerous for children and elderly family members.
- Gas Leaks: If you smell gas (like rotten eggs) near appliances, evacuate and call an emergency plumber right away—this is life-threatening.
- Major Leaks: Any leak that's causing visible water damage to ceilings, walls, or floors needs urgent attention.
- Blocked Toilet (Only One): If it's your only toilet and it's overflowing, it's an emergency.

When Should You Call an Emergency Plumber in Roseville?
Call an emergency plumber if:
- Water is actively flooding your home
- You have no water at all (especially in winter)
- There's a sewage smell or backup
- You suspect a gas leak
- A pipe has burst
Wait until morning if:
- A single drain is slow (but not completely blocked)
- Your water pressure is slightly low
- A faucet drips slowly
- Your toilet runs occasionally
In Roseville's climate, when temperatures plummet below freezing, even a small leak can become a big problem fast. If you're unsure, it's better to call. Many emergency plumbers offer free phone advice to help you decide.
How Much Does an Emergency Plumber Cost in Roseville, MN?
This is the question every homeowner asks. Emergency plumbing services do cost more than scheduled appointments—typically 50-100% higher—because you're paying for immediate response, after-hours work, and priority service. Here's a breakdown for Roseville:
- Emergency Call-Out Fee: $100-$200. This covers the plumber coming to your home, usually within 30-60 minutes in Roseville.
- Hourly Rates: $150-$300 per hour, depending on the time (nights, weekends, and holidays are higher).
- Common Emergency Repairs:
- Fixing a burst pipe: $300-$1,000
- Clearing a severe sewer blockage: $200-$600
- Repairing a water heater: $400-$800
- Gas leak repair: $200-$500
Why are emergency plumbers more expensive? They maintain 24/7 staffing, specialized equipment ready to go, and vehicles stocked for any crisis. In Roseville, where winter storms can make travel hazardous, they also account for weather risks. How to Get an Emergency Plumber and What to Do While You Wait
If you have a plumbing emergency:
- Call Immediately: Don't wait. The sooner you call, the less damage occurs.
- Shut Off Water: Locate your main water shut-off valve (often in the basement or near the water heater) and turn it off.
- Turn Off Electricity: If water is near electrical outlets or appliances, shut off power at the breaker.
- Contain the Water: Use towels, buckets, or mops to minimize damage.
- Clear a Path: Make sure the plumber can easily access the problem area.
- Take Photos: For insurance claims, document the damage.
In Roseville, where basements are common, keep your shut-off valve accessible and label it clearly. During winter, ensure pipes in unheated areas like garages are insulated to prevent freezes.
Local Factors Affecting Emergency Plumbing in Roseville
Roseville's unique environment impacts plumbing emergencies:
- Climate: Our harsh winters mean frozen and burst pipes are a major issue. Summer storms can lead to sewer backups.
- Housing: Many homes built in the 1950s-1970s have galvanized steel pipes that corrode over time. Newer homes use PEX or copper.
- Geography: Being in the Twin Cities metro means quick service is available, but also that older infrastructure exists.
- Regulations: Minnesota plumbing codes require specific insulation for pipes to prevent freezing—make sure your home is up to code.
Seasonal issues: In winter, watch for pipes in exterior walls freezing. In spring, heavy rain can overwhelm sump pumps in basements. Year-round, hard water in our area can lead to mineral buildup in pipes and water heaters.
